PURI BHAJI RECIPE


Puri bhaji is an integral part of the north Indian cuisine. In every festive food you will find its presence. Pooris are fried wheat flour balls and bhaji is made with boiled potatoes and spices.


Ingredients:


Ingredients for Pooris:

2 cup Wheat flour
1 tsp cumin seeds
2 tbsp. Curd
Water to knead dough
1 tsp black pepper powder
Salt to taste
Oil to deep fry

Ingredients for Bhaji
2 Potatoes (boiled)
1 Chopped onion
2 Chopped green chilies
1/2 tsp. Ginger finely chopped
1/2 tsp.Crushed garlic
3-4 pinches Turmeric powder
1 tsp. Lemon juice
1 tbsp. Oil
1 tbsp. Coriander finely chopped
1/2 tsp. each Cumin & mustard seeds


How to make puri bhaji:
  • For Pooris :
  • Mix curd in the flour and add salt.
  • Knead soft pliable dough with water.
  • Keep aside for 15 minutes. Divide dough into 10-12 parts, shape into balls.
  • Roll each into 4 rounds with the help of some oil or dough.
  • Heat oil in a deep pan, fry on both sides till light brown.
  • Drain the oil on a kitchen paper. Serve hot with bhaji.
  • For Bhaji :
  • Heat oil in a pan, put the mustard seeds and cumin seeds and allow it to splutter.
  • Add the chopped onions and sauté it till it becomes tender.
  • Add the ginger, garlic, chilly paste and fry it for a minute.
  • Peel the potatoes and crush them with hand and add to the mixture.
  • Add salt, turmeric and lemon juice.
  • Add water and let it simmer on low heat for five minutes..
  • Transfer to bowl, garnish with chopped coriander leaves.
  • Serve hot with pooris.
